Community Profile
The community surrounding St Elizabeth School has a median household income of $75,585. It is a well-educated community where 41%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$709,100, with a median rent of $1,742/month. The area has a poverty rate of 17.0%. The average commute in the area is 41 minutes, which is above the national average.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.

Frequently Asked Questions
Common questions about St Elizabeth School
What grades does St Elizabeth School serve?
St Elizabeth School serves students in grades Pre-K through 8th.
How many students attend St Elizabeth School?
St Elizabeth School has an enrollment of approximately 220 students.
What is the student-teacher ratio at St Elizabeth School?
The student-teacher ratio at St Elizabeth School is 12.2:1.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student. The national average is approximately 11:1 for private schools.
How does St Elizabeth School rank in NY?
St Elizabeth School is ranked #469 out of 991 private schools in NY.
What is St Elizabeth School's MySchoolScout rating?
St Elizabeth School has a composite rating of 6.3 out of 10 on MySchoolScout. This score combines academic performance, student growth, and school environment into a single score. Equity data is shown separately for context.
Is St Elizabeth School a private school?
Yes, St Elizabeth School is a private coeducational school with a Roman Catholic affiliation. Private schools are not required to participate in state standardized testing, so academic performance data may be limited compared to public schools.
Is St Elizabeth School a religious school?
St Elizabeth School has a Roman Catholic religious affiliation.
